Beverly A. Sellers, 78, Ottawa, died Thursday, Jan. 31, 2013, at Sunflower Plaza in Ottawa.
A graveside inurnment service is planned for 10 a.m. Tuesday, Feb. 5, 2013, at Mt. Calvary Cemetery, Ottawa. A rosary will be said at 6:30 p.m. Monday, Feb. 4, 2013, at Dengel & Son Mortuary, followed by a family and friends visitation from 7 p.m. to 8 p.m. Monday.
She was born Wednesday, Nov. 14, 1934, in Sioux City, Iowa, the daughter of Gene Paul and Frances A. (Klienschmidt) Mille.
She moved to Ottawa with her family in 1939, lived two years in California and returned to Ottawa in 1954.
Beverly graduated from Ottawa High School with the class of 1952.
She started as an operator for the Bell Telephone Company in 1952 in Palo Alto, Calif., and transferred to Kansas City and then to Ottawa; took 10 years off and then later was employed with United Telecom, later known as Sprint, as a fraud investigator, retiring in 1995.
Beverly was a member of Sacred Heart Catholic Church in Ottawa.
In August 1954, Beverly was united in marriage with Gerald Sellers in Kansas City, Kan. They later divorced.
She was preceded in death by her parents, Gene P. and Frances A. Mille; infant brother, Paul Mille; brother, David Mille; son-in-law, Jack Judd; and sisters-in-law, Carol Mille and Nancy Mille.
Survivors include a son, Michael Ray Sellers and wife, Cynthia, Nowata, Okla.; a daughter, Linda Judd, Grove, Okla.; grandson, David Sellers and wife, Lorie, Nowata, Okla.; step-granddaughter, Ivie Judd-Barbee and husband, Gerald, Jay, Okla.; two great-granddaughters, Breann Sellers and Nicole Sellers; three brothers, Kenneth Mille, Ottawa, Richard Mille and wife, Sheri, Versailles, Mo., and Frank Mille and wife, Sharon, Coeur D Alene, Idaho; and a sister, Mary Fowler, Ottawa.
